✨Tip Number 1
Research the New Zealand civil construction market thoroughly. Understand the key players, current projects, and industry trends. This knowledge will not only help you in interviews but also show your genuine interest in relocating.
✨Tip Number 2
Network with professionals already working in New Zealand's civil construction sector. Use platforms like LinkedIn to connect with them, ask questions about their experiences, and seek advice on making the transition smoother.
✨Tip Number 3
Consider obtaining any necessary certifications or qualifications that are recognised in New Zealand. This can enhance your employability and demonstrate your commitment to adapting to the local industry standards.
✨Tip Number 4
Prepare for potential interviews by practising common questions specific to project engineering in civil construction. Tailor your responses to highlight your relevant experience and how it aligns with the needs of New Zealand employers.
